Warren County SchoolEducation is a high priority of Warren County citizens as witnessed by the newly constructed Warren County High School and Hickory Creek Elementary School .  Along with eight other elementary schools, one middle school, and four parochial schools, students in Warren County are offered educational opportunities found only in larger school systems.  Each school has "state of the art" computer labs, Internet connections, and distance learning capabilities.

Parental involvement is stressed at all schools.  Active Parent-Teacher organizations insure community involvement in the education process.  In addition, a strong business and education partnership provides an atmosphere where graduating students are prepared for the world of work.  All public schools are accredited by the Southern Association of Colleges and Schools.  More information on Warren County Schools can be found at www.warrenschools.com.


Motlow State Community College Motlow State Community College , McMinnville Campus, offers both basic educational classes and career-oriented educational classes. Students can complete an Associate of Arts or Associate of Science degree in General Studies or an Associate of Applied Science degree in Business Technology at the McMinnville location. Motlow College maintains a close, positive working relationship with area business and industry by working side-by-side to provide training, facilities and guidance to employees, employers and managers throughout the area.

Tennessee Technology Center

The Tennessee Technology Center at McMinnville provides students with immediate job placement skills for the working world.  The mission of TTC-McMinnville is to respond to the economic need of the institution's service area with relevant workforce development and training programs that are technologically advanced and are inherently designed to contribute to the student's intellectual and social development.  Full-time programs are offered in Automotive Technology, Business Systems Technology, Computer Maintenance Technology, Computer Operations Technology, Industrial Electronics, Industrial Maintenance, Machine Tool Technology, Special Industry, Technology Foundations, Medical Office Assistant, Practical Nursing and Surgical Technology.  Part-time programs are offered and include such topics as FrontPage XP, PowerPoint XP, Windows XP, Cad I and Cad II.


Universities with a 100 mile radius include: Tennessee Technological University, Cookeville; Middle Tennessee State University, Murfreesboro; David Lipscomb, Belmont College, Tennessee State University and Vanderbilt University, Nashville; and the University of the South, Sewanee.

Transportation Resources

Transportation-whether by land, air, or rail- is vital for the growth and development of any community.  Situated in the geographic center of Tennessee , Warren County provides easy access of interstate systems 24 & 40.  Crisscrossing the county are Tennessee Highways 8, 30, 55, 56, 108, and U.S. Highway 70S.  This system of modern arteries conveniently links McMinnville-Warren County with state metropolitan areas of Chattanooga , Knoxville , Nashville (capitol), and Memphis .

Manufacturers and businesses dependent on freight lines for shipping and receiving goods will be pleased to note Warren County offers several interstate common carriers.  Caney Fork and Western Railroad, a short line railroad, provides rail services which link with national carrier CSX Railway.  A fully staffed modern municipal airport services Warren County and the surrounding area.  Offering 5,300 feet of runway for both private and commercial use, the facility is located three miles northwest of McMinnville.  Additionally, Nashville International Airport , offering over 200 daily flights, is located 75 miles northwest of McMinnville-Warren County .

The 60 mile Caney Fork and Western Railroad starts in Tullahoma , connecting to the CSX with a small interchange yard.  The yard is located across from the point where Route 55 becomes a divided highway.  Trains see a good mix of freight cars due to the various industries along the line.


Medical Care Facilities
River Park Hospital

River Park Hospital provides our region with a new 127-bed facility offering the latest in technology, and is JCAHO accredited.  This hospital has over four hundred employees and a medical staff of over forty active physicians and additional specialty physicians.   River Park Hospital also provides to this community a diabetes center, rehabilitation center, occupational medicine, physical and respiratory therapy departments, family birth center, imaging & diagnostics, oncology, radiology, nephrology, neurology and gastroenterology services.  The medical staff, along with a variety of courtesy/consulting staff, work side by side in this new facility.  For addition information about River Park Hospital , visit their website at www.riverparkhospital.com.

Immediate emergency care is provided by the Warren County Emergency Ambulance Service, Warren County Rescue Squad and the River Park Emergency Service.  Mental health care needs are met through the Cheer Mental Health Center .  The Warren County Public Health Department provides medical services for residents with two nursing homes and eight home health care agencies offering readily available healthcare support in a family setting.
